AtlantiCare in Galloway Township is seeking a Registered Nurse to join the interdisciplinary team. This role involves overseeing patient care across various settings, including inpatient and outpatient environments. Essential duties include documenting care actions and coordinating plans with the medical team.
The ideal candidate should have a valid New Jersey nursing license, a strong background in clinical applications, and must value patient education. BLS certification is required, and a BSN is preferred. Join us to make a difference in patient care!
The Registered Nurse is a member of the interdisciplinary team working in collaboration with the Physician. The Registered Nurse utilizes the nursing care process consistent with their license and/or certification including initiation of culturally competent continuum of care including inpatient, outpatient and community settings. The Registered Nurse is responsible to oversee any necessary coordination of the interdisciplinary plan of care and provides for its consistency with the medical treatment plan.
